Finding Right Hand Drive Conversions

If you take your US made car to a country where cars drive on the right hand side of the road you may want to get the controls moved. When looking for right hand drive conversions there are a few options available to you. Before you get these modifications done there are some important things to consider and a little research should be done before you make a final decision.

The work that is needed to modify a vehicle is quite technical and more changes are needed than simply moving the driving controls. The foot pedals and the steering wheel will have to be relocated as well as some switches and other interior parts. The underside of your car will also need some attention and the suspension system and brakes will need adjusting or modifying so that the vehicle can be driven safely.

The most cost effective way to convert your car is to order and buy a kit from a high street auto spares supplier or web based retailer. There are kits available for a lot of car models and they are supplied with all fitting instructions and diagrams. It is worth bearing in mind that after completing the work a lot of components, metal springs and fixings will be visible inside your vehicle.

When you are searching for a suitable kit, a web based parts retailer is a good option and their web pages have some very detailed information. The online suppliers will have many kits available which they will dispatch to your home address. As well as the conversion kit you may also need specialist tools and garage equipment and your kit supplier will stock these extra items.

For the best results, giving your vehicle to an engineering firm and letting them to do the modification work, is the best option. There are companies that will carry out these modifications to very high standards. It will cost considerably more than a kit conversion but it is worth noting that the finished results are superior and the work is going to be covered by a guarantee.

Locating a company to do the work on your vehicle is quite easy after you have done a little shopping around. Many firms have a number in the local telephone directory, some will advertise in newspapers and motoring magazines and others can be found online. Speaking to a local car mechanic can also produce results and they may help by recommending a company.

Whichever option you choose it is important to have all of the mechanical work inspected for safety. Most engineering companies will have the car examined and they will issue certificates covering the modification work. If the work is done using a kit as a project, your car can be submitted for the inspections at a later date, prior to driving it on the public roads.

When you make any major alterations to a vehicle, the manufacturer warranty will no longer be applicable. The resale value of the car can also be affected after these conversions have been done. It is also a requirement that you inform your vehicle insurance company about any modifications and your payments could be higher.
